Code P023D Land Rover Description

The Powertrain Control Module Monitors the Manifold Absolute Pressure Sensor (MAP) and Turbocharger/Supercharger Boost Sensor. The PCM sets the OBDII code when the either the Manifold Absolute Pressure Sensor or Turbocharger/Supercharger Boost Sensor is out of factory specifications.

What are the Possible Causes of the DTC P023D Land Rover?

  • Faulty Manifold Absolute Pressure Sensor (MAP)
  • Manifold Absolute Pressure Sensor (MAP) harness is open or shorted
  • Manifold Absolute Pressure Sensor (MAP) circuit poor electrical connection
  • Faulty Turbocharger/Supercharger Boost Sensor
  • Turbocharger/Supercharger Boost Sensor harness is open or shorted
  • Turbocharger/Supercharger Boost Sensor circuit poor electrical connection

How to Fix the DTC P023D Land Rover?

Review the 'Possible Causes' above and visually examine the corresponding wiring harness and connectors. Check for damaged components and inspect connector pins for signs of being broken, bent, pushed out, or corroded.

What is the Cost to Diagnose the Code?

Labor: 1.0

To diagnose the P023D Land Rover code, it typically requires 1.0 hour of labor. Rates vary by location, vehicle, and shop. Many shops charge between $80–$150 per hour; dealerships and metro areas may be higher, independents may be lower.

Frequently Asked Questions about P023D Land Rover Code

1. What are the common symptoms of OBDII code P023D in a Land Rover?

- Common symptoms include reduced engine power, hesitation or surging during acceleration, poor fuel efficiency, and illuminated check engine light.

2. What does the OBDII code P023D for a Land Rover indicate?

- The code P023D indicates a discrepancy between the Manifold Absolute Pressure (MAP) sensor reading and the expected boost pressure from the turbocharger or supercharger.

3. What are the possible causes of the P023D code in a Land Rover?

- Possible causes include a faulty MAP sensor, issues with the turbocharger or supercharger system, a vacuum leak, wiring problems, or a faulty engine control module (ECM).

4. How can I diagnose the P023D code in my Land Rover?

- Diagnosing the P023D code may involve checking the MAP sensor readings, inspecting the turbocharger or supercharger components, performing a boost pressure test, and conducting a thorough visual inspection of related components.

5. Can I continue to drive my Land Rover with the P023D code present?

- It is not recommended to drive your vehicle with the P023D code active, as it can lead to poor engine performance, potential damage to the turbocharger or supercharger system, and other issues. It is best to address the problem promptly.

6. How can I repair the P023D code in my Land Rover?

- Repairing the P023D code may involve replacing the faulty MAP sensor, addressing any turbocharger or supercharger issues, fixing vacuum leaks, repairing wiring faults, or reprogramming the ECM if necessary.

7. Are there any maintenance tips to prevent the P023D code from occurring in my Land Rover?

- Regularly servicing your Land Rover, including checking and replacing air filters, inspecting the turbocharger or supercharger system, and ensuring proper vacuum system function, can help prevent the occurrence of the P023D code.
